[Python] 動的計画法 ABC219D
ABC219D 動的計画法で解く。 動的計画法による外部設計は次のようになります。 dpの定義: dp[i][j][k]=(i番目までの弁当で、たこ焼きはj個、たい焼きはk個食べる最小の個数) ...
46 search resultsShowing 1~20 results
You need to log-in
ABC219D 動的計画法で解く。 動的計画法による外部設計は次のようになります。 dpの定義: dp[i][j][k]=(i番目までの弁当で、たこ焼きはj個、たい焼きはk個食べる最小の個数) ...
ABC218C S と T に含まれる # の個数が異なる場合、答えは明らかに No です。そうでない場合を考えます。 S に対して 90 度回転を何回行うか 4 通りを全探索します。回転操作を...
ABC215D これはABC215 D - Coprime 2を参考にした、自分用のメモである。 $gcd(A_i,k)=1$となるのは,$k$が$A_i$の任意の素因数を持たないことと同じです...
ABC214D 以下では、辺の重みは相異なると仮定します。制約にそのような条件はありませんが、添字の大小による tie-break などを行えばよいです。 各 $i , (1 \leq i \l...
ABC210C 問題文通りの全探索を実装すると、計算量は$O(K(N-K+1))$でありTLE。 連想配列を用いたしゃくとり法をすれば、$O(N\log N)$ サンプルコード from col...
ABC209D 当内容は、他サイトを参考に自分用に編集したものです。 サンプルコード from collections import deque def main(): [N, Q] = [in...
ABC207D 次のような認識に基づく解法が考えられる。 ➀ 座標空間における回転 ➁ 複素数平面における回転 ➂ 辺の長さによる合同 ここでは➀に基づく解法を取る。点集合 $(X={(x_1,...
ARC005C 01-BFSのちょっと丁寧な解説 辺の長さが "0" または "1" である有向グラフにおいて、ある1つの始点から全頂点への最短路の長さを効率的な計算時間で求めるアルゴリズムであ...
ABC200D 動的計画法の実装を工夫すると、時間計算量は$O(MN^2) (M=200)$となる。 dpの定義: $dp[r][s]=和の余りがrとなる正整数の集合がs$ サンプルコード M=...
ZONE2021C チームメンバーの選び方を全探索すると、選び方が最大で $4.5×10^9$ 個になるため TLE してしまいます。 最大値の最小値のような形の問題では、答えを二分探索し、「答...
ABC199D $3^N$ 通りの塗り方を全部探索する方法では実行時間制限に間に合わせるのは困難です。 ある頂点iの色を決めた時、iと辺で繋がっている頂点の色の探索候補は2通りしかないから、グラ...
ABC199C 1文字を入れ替える操作の計算量は$O(1)$である。$T=2$のとき、前半と後半を1文字ずつ入れ替える操作は$O(N)$となり、合計$O(QN)$で間に合わない。この操作処理を単...
ABC192D $X$ が 1 文字のとき、答えは 0 か 1 です。以下、そうでない場合を考えます。 $X_{(n)}$は $n$ の狭義単調増加関数です。したがって、$ \max (\ n\...
パフォーマンス マイワースト2を更新orz A 問題なし B []を消し忘れるという初歩的なWA。 C 問題の意図が不明。質問を見ると返答に詳しい説明があるが、これは不公平であろう。入試業務の経...
パフォーマンス マイワースト2 A 問題なし B Pythonの動的型付け仕様への認識が甘く、整数浮動小数点演算が発生していることに気付かず、そこでの誤差が不正確な判定を起こし、WAを招いた。自...
ABC190C $K$を筆頭に制約が狭いので、全探索の時間計算量を検討すると、$O(2^K(N+M+K))$で適合する。 bit全探索で $co[i]$ を皿 $i$ 置かれたボールの数として、...
ABC032D 01ナップサック問題 N個の荷物があり、$i(1\le i\le N)$ 番目の荷物には価値 $v_i$ と重さ $w_i$ が割り当てられている。 許容重量Wのナップサックが1...
AOJ Knapsack Problem 個数制限なしのナップサック問題 価値が $v_i$ 重さが $w_i$ であるような $N$ 種類の品物と、容量が $W$ のナップザックがあります。 ...
パフォーマンス 問題なし A 問題なし B 問題なし C 二分探索木を構築せよという問題かと勘違い。本とネットの調査によって、そういう趣旨の問題ではないかもと迷う。この状態で進めると、時間ロス過...
ABC015D 個数制限付きのナップサック問題です。ちなみに全探索で考えると、N 個の中から K 個選んで入れる・入れないを全て試すと $O(2^N)$ となり、間に合いません。動的計画法であれ...
46 search resultsShowing 1~20 results
Qiita is a knowledge sharing service for engineers.